“d. From Q1, we had easier product margin comparables due to prior year timing. The benefits, as you mentioned, the transportation cost relief is now flowing through margin as expected. We also benefited from product mix, and we continue to see great momentum with our PPI benefits across the merchandising portfolio. Those benefits are offset by continued investment in supply chain and the expansion specifically on market delivery. We called out shrink being neutral, as Joe mentioned, continuing to drive tech solutions to manage some of the industry-wide challenges there. And all in, as we look at the full year, we still expect roughly gross margins flat across the year. So puts and takes there, just like Q2, supply chain expansion continued pressure from some of the Pro growth initiatives. And then we expect continued benefits across the back half of the year from private brand penetration, supplier clawbacks, lower transportation costs and initiatives that we're seeing across the pricing portfolio.
